Class Overview:

Ashwaubenon High School Choirs provide opportunities for students to CREATE, PERFORM, RESPOND to, and CONNECT with vocal music through large and small group instruction.

MIXED CHOIR

This is a course for the emerging vocalist. The objectives of this class are to pursue musical excellence in vocal technique and music literacy while having fun singing cooperatively in a performing choir.

Meets: 2B Full Year
Credits: 1
Grades: 9, 10, 11, 12
Requirements: N/A

  

  

TREBLE CHOIR

This is a performance choir for the intermediate, treble voiced singer. Singing technique and music reading are stressed, moving through the basics quickly into more advanced levels. Students in this course are expected to have mature voices and display a serious attitude towards choral excellence.

Meets: 2A Full Year
Credits: 1
Grades: 10, 11, 12
Requirements: Audition/Teacher Recommendation

CONCERT CHOIR

This is a course for the mature, advanced vocalist which explores various composers and elements of music including theory, history, and style through performance. The students will have multiple performance opportunities in the community. 

Meets: 3B Full Year
Credits: 1
Grades: 10, 11, 12
Requirements: Audition/Teacher Recommendation

  

ENCORE

This ensemble offers extensive performance experience based on solid vocal technique. Choreography and showmanship will be included. Students will be selected by audition in vocal and dance skills and will be required to make a firm commitment to the group. 

Instrumentalists will be auditioned as needed. Participation and attendance in scheduled concerts, competitions, festivals, and rehearsals is expected of all members.

Meets: AF, Monday 7:30-9:00PM, Thursday 3:00-4:00PM
Credits: .5
Grades: 9, 10, 11, 12
Requirements: Audition/Enrolled in Curricular Music Course
